#75f5a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#75f5a9 is composed of 45.9% red, 96.1%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 31%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 144.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 71%. #75f5a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#eaffff with #00eb53.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#75f5a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010804 is the darkest color, while #f5f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#75f5a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b6b5 is the less saturated color, while #6ffba8 is the most saturated one.
